嵌入式系统的故障排除技巧试题及答案_第1页
嵌入式系统的故障排除技巧试题及答案_第2页
嵌入式系统的故障排除技巧试题及答案_第3页
嵌入式系统的故障排除技巧试题及答案_第4页
嵌入式系统的故障排除技巧试题及答案_第5页
已阅读5页,还剩6页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

嵌入式系统的故障排除技巧试题及答案姓名:____________________

一、单项选择题(每题2分,共10题)

1.下列关于嵌入式系统故障排除的基本步骤,错误的是:

A.确定故障现象

B.收集故障信息

C.分析故障原因

D.直接更换硬件

2.以下哪种方法不适合嵌入式系统故障的初步诊断?

A.查看系统日志

B.进行系统重启

C.检查电源连接

D.运行性能测试软件

3.在嵌入式系统故障排除中,以下哪种方法可以快速定位故障点?

A.逐步排除法

B.逻辑分析法

C.系统自检

D.以上都是

4.以下哪种工具不是嵌入式系统调试中常用的?

A.逻辑分析仪

B.示波器

C.串口调试助手

D.虚拟机

5.以下关于嵌入式系统硬件故障排除的说法,错误的是:

A.首先检查电源和接地

B.逐一检查各个模块的连接线

C.忽略软件故障,直接更换硬件

D.分析故障现象,判断故障原因

6.以下哪种情况可能引起嵌入式系统软件故障?

A.系统过载

B.电源不稳定

C.硬件损坏

D.以上都是

7.在嵌入式系统故障排除中,以下哪种方法可以帮助定位软件故障?

A.逐步排除法

B.逻辑分析法

C.调试代码

D.以上都是

8.以下哪种方法不是嵌入式系统故障排除中的常见方法?

A.故障隔离法

B.故障定位法

C.故障预测法

D.故障排除法

9.在嵌入式系统故障排除中,以下哪种情况属于软件故障?

A.系统无法启动

B.系统运行缓慢

C.系统出现死机

D.以上都是

10.以下关于嵌入式系统故障排除的说法,正确的是:

A.故障排除过程中,需要具备丰富的理论知识

B.故障排除过程中,需要具备丰富的实践经验

C.故障排除过程中,需要具备良好的沟通技巧

D.以上都是

二、多项选择题(每题3分,共10题)

1.嵌入式系统故障排除时,以下哪些是可能的原因?

A.硬件故障

B.软件错误

C.电源问题

D.环境因素

2.在进行嵌入式系统硬件故障诊断时,以下哪些步骤是必要的?

A.检查电源供应

B.检查连接线

C.检查散热情况

D.检查硬件模块

3.以下哪些工具在嵌入式系统软件调试中非常有用?

A.调试器

B.跟踪器

C.代码编辑器

D.性能分析工具

4.以下哪些情况可能导致嵌入式系统软件故障?

A.编译器设置错误

B.操作系统内核错误

C.应用程序逻辑错误

D.硬件资源不足

5.嵌入式系统故障排除时,以下哪些方法可以帮助缩小故障范围?

A.分段测试

B.逐步排除

C.故障隔离

D.故障预测

6.在嵌入式系统故障排除中,以下哪些是常见的故障现象?

A.系统崩溃

B.运行缓慢

C.无法启动

D.数据丢失

7.以下哪些方法可以用来诊断嵌入式系统中的软件问题?

A.单步执行

B.断点调试

C.日志分析

D.调试代码

8.在嵌入式系统设计中,以下哪些措施可以减少故障发生的可能性?

A.使用冗余设计

B.优化代码

C.定期更新软件

D.增加硬件冗余

9.以下哪些是嵌入式系统故障排除时的关键步骤?

A.确定故障现象

B.收集故障信息

C.分析故障原因

D.制定修复方案

10.在嵌入式系统故障排除中,以下哪些是可能需要考虑的因素?

A.系统负载

B.环境温度

C.电源电压

D.硬件兼容性

三、判断题(每题2分,共10题)

1.嵌入式系统故障排除过程中,软件故障比硬件故障更容易诊断。(×)

2.在进行嵌入式系统硬件故障排除时,更换硬件部件是首选的方法。(×)

3.嵌入式系统故障排除时,环境因素如温度和湿度对故障诊断没有影响。(×)

4.嵌入式系统软件故障通常可以通过重新启动系统来解决。(×)

5.嵌入式系统故障排除时,记录详细的故障日志对于后续分析非常有帮助。(√)

6.嵌入式系统中的固件更新可能会引入新的故障,因此在更新前应进行充分测试。(√)

7.在嵌入式系统设计中,使用静态代码分析工具可以有效预防软件故障。(√)

8.嵌入式系统故障排除时,如果遇到无法解决的问题,应该立即寻求外部技术支持。(×)

9.嵌入式系统硬件故障排除时,如果怀疑是电源问题,应首先检查电源供应的稳定性。(√)

10.嵌入式系统故障排除过程中,进行系统自检可以帮助快速定位故障点。(√)

四、简答题(每题5分,共6题)

1.简述嵌入式系统故障排除的基本步骤。

2.解释什么是嵌入式系统的冗余设计,并说明其在故障排除中的作用。

3.如何区分嵌入式系统中的硬件故障和软件故障?

4.在嵌入式系统调试过程中,如何使用调试器进行代码级别的调试?

5.简述嵌入式系统故障排除时,如何利用系统日志进行故障分析。

6.请列举至少三种嵌入式系统硬件故障的常见原因,并简要说明相应的排查方法。

试卷答案如下

一、单项选择题答案及解析:

1.D

解析:直接更换硬件不是故障排除的基本步骤,而是最后一种可能的方法。

2.D

解析:虚拟机不属于嵌入式系统调试的工具,它是虚拟化技术的一部分。

3.D

解析:逐步排除法、逻辑分析法和系统自检都是故障排除中常用的方法。

4.D

解析:串口调试助手是用于调试嵌入式系统的工具,不属于硬件工具。

5.C

解析:忽略软件故障直接更换硬件会导致误判,应该先分析软件问题。

6.D

解析:软件故障可能由编译器设置错误、操作系统内核错误或应用程序逻辑错误引起。

7.D

解析:逐步排除法、逻辑分析法和调试代码都是定位软件故障的有效方法。

8.C

解析:故障预测法不属于常见的故障排除方法,而是预防措施的一种。

9.D

解析:制定修复方案是故障排除的关键步骤之一,确保问题得到有效解决。

10.D

解析:系统负载、环境温度、电源电压和硬件兼容性都是需要考虑的因素。

二、多项选择题答案及解析:

1.A,B,C,D

解析:硬件故障、软件错误、电源问题和环境因素都可能导致嵌入式系统故障。

2.A,B,C,D

解析:检查电源供应、连接线、散热情况和硬件模块是硬件故障诊断的必要步骤。

3.A,B,C,D

解析:调试器、跟踪器、代码编辑器和性能分析工具都是嵌入式系统调试中常用的工具。

4.A,B,C,D

解析:编译器设置错误、操作系统内核错误、应用程序逻辑错误和硬件资源不足都可能引起软件故障。

5.A,B,C,D

解析:分段测试、逐步排除、故障隔离和故障预测都是缩小故障范围的有效方法。

6.A,B,C,D

解析:系统崩溃、运行缓慢、无法启动和数据丢失都是常见的嵌入式系统故障现象。

7.A,B,C,D

解析:单步执行、断点调试、日志分析和调试代码都是诊断软件问题的常用方法。

8.A,B,C,D

解析:使用冗余设计、优化代码、定期更新软件和增加硬件冗余都可以减少故障发生的可能性。

9.A,B,C,D

解析:确定故障现象、收集故障信息、分析故障原因和制定修复方案是故障排除的关键步骤。

10.A,B,C,D

解析:系统负载、环境温度、电源电压和硬件兼容性都是嵌入式系统故障排除时需要考虑的因素。

三、判断题答案及解析:

1.×

解析:软件故障通常比硬件故障更难以诊断,因为软件问题可能表现为多种形式。

2.×

解析:更换硬件部件不是首选方法,而是经过诊断和测试后的备选方案。

3.×

解析:环境因素对故障诊断有很大影响,如温度和湿度可能导致硬件和软件故障。

4.×

解析:软件故障可能需要更复杂的解决方法,如更新驱动程序或修复代码。

5.√

解析:详细的故障日志对于后续分析非常有帮助,可以提供故障发生时的系统状态信息。

6.√

解析:固件更新可能引入新问题,因此进行充分测试是必要的预防措施。

7.√

解析:静态代码分析工具可以帮助识别潜在的错误和不足,预防软件故障。

8.×

解析:在故障排除过程中,应先尝试内部解决,而不是立即寻求外部支持。

9.√

解析:检查电源供应的稳定性是诊断电源问题的重要步骤。

10.√

解析:系统自检可以帮助快速定位故障点,是故障排除的有效方法之一。

四、简答题答案及解析:

1.嵌入式系统故障排除的基本步骤包括:确定故障现象、收集故障信息、分析故障原因、制定修复方案和实施修复。

2.冗余设计是指在嵌入式系统中添加额外的硬件或软件组件,以防止单个组件的故障导致整个系统失效。它在故障排除中的作用是提供备份和恢复机制,从而提高系统的可靠性和可用性。

3.区分硬件故障和软件故障的方法包括:检查硬件连接、电源供应和散热情况;分析系统日志和错误信息;尝试重新启动系统;进行代码调试和软件更新。

4.使用调试器进行代码级别的调试包括:设置断点、单步执

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论